While your auto insurance company can not pull your full motor vehicle report, it does pull a summary noting your newest tickets, crashes, and sentences. The lookback duration for your MVR varies by state and the insurance company. Generally, this period Visit this link is between 3 and five years, yet it can be a lot longer. For example, in California, a DUI remains on the MVR document and counts as an offense for ten years, whereas an accident has a look-back period of 3 years. An exceptional rise after a mishap will usually last anywhere from 3 to five years-- however, again, this varies by business and state. The surcharge will certainly commonly lower in time as long as you don't create any more crashes. In Florida, nevertheless, a collision goes on your document if you were provided a website traffic citation as an outcome of the crash. Many insurer don't approve brand-new consumers who have had more than 2 or 3 insurance claims in the past 3-5 years. It differs-- your state and the insurance company you use will certainly affect the increase in your premium. Some kinds of accidents are even worse than others-- for instance, a driving under the influence event is likely to activate a nonrenewal from virtually every insurance company.
